Abstract
Crisis management teams need to make decisions; they also need to increase the awareness of the project through regular meetings. The chairman of the crisis management team has power to alert and mobilize the involved parties. The crisis management team needs to learn from history. Training and drills need to be provided to the appropriate peple; all leaders should be well prepared and know what they should do when a crisis happens. This chapter suggests a well-designed crisis management plan for human swine influenza in a hospital setting to prevent the situation from becoming worse when a disaster happens.
